According to our information, the protection around Minister Olivier Dussopt has been strengthened and has gone from 1 to 3 security guards. Agents who are with him every day, also in his spare time.
If the minister’s entourage explains that he is morally “armoured”, the ex-socialist has nevertheless shown himself to be very affected, and this on several occasions in his last days. In particular, when he was called a “murderer” by the LFI deputy Aurélien Saintoul this Monday during the review of the pension reform.

Guillotine images and more direct threats
This increased protection of Olivier Dussopt comes as the minister is also receiving more and more homophobic messages on his social networks, according to our information.
But, more generally, many intimidating messages and even death threats, again according to information from BFMTV. In particular, he received images of the guillotine, but also more direct threats.
